what was the power at the wheels?

For 144bhp on a 19 the wheel output should be between 120 - 130bhp

I laugh heartily when muppets say they have 150bhp then show me they have 95 bhp at the wheels.

A good standard one can put out nearly 130bhp at the wheels. Alexs ph2 hatch was pumping out 126bhp at the wheels at a rsc/cs rolling road day, he was oen of the highest, that was a totally stock car.

hmmmm phone call revealed they dont have it on record, and apparently they dont give a power at the wheels reading because it is inconsistent.
Power at the flywheel is the accurate figure.
I asked him to give an educated guess at 144bhp @ the flywheel to power at the wheels and he said it would prolly be about 20hp less than the flywheeel figure so we at roughly 124 bhp @ the wheels
